Concept of Teams
The idea that individuals working collaboratively towards a common goal achieve better results than working in isolation.
Norms and Conformity
Relate to the implicit rules governing expected behavior within a group and the extent to which individuals adjust their behavior to align with group standards.
Team Dynamics
The behavioral relationships and processes that influence the effectiveness and productivity of a team.
Organizational Rules
Guidelines and procedures established within an organization to regulate behavior and processes, ensuring smooth operations and consistency.
